Oldest trees - the Bristlecone pine



Methuselah the oldest tree on earth is 4,734 years old. The exact location is kept secret, but it is known that Methuselah is one of those magnificent bristlecone pines that grow very slowly for thousands of years at about 10 000 feet in the the White Mountains of north western California. Bristlecone Pines live for so long because of their amazing ability to die slowly, It hard to believe that these trees were living when the egyptians were building the pyramids.
